После установки ati-drivers не стартует xdm

Приобрёл несколько месяцев назад ноутбук hp pavilion dv6-6b51er с двумя видеокартами (AMD Radeon HD 6770M и Intel HD Graphics 3000). При использовании драйверов intel, интегрированная видеокарта работает прекрасно. Но при установке проприетарных драйверов ati-drivers и выполнения команды aticonfig --initial не стартует xdm. Пробовал ставить все версии драйверов с 12.4 до 12.11_beta, везде одно и то же. Ни дискретная ни интегрированная видеокарты не хотят работать с fglrx драйвером. Пробовал пересобирать ядро якобы для работы с fglrx по инструкции http://wiki.cchtml.com/index.php/Gentoo_Installation_Guide , но после загрузки с такого ядра, система вообще зависает и не даёт зайти даже в консоль.

Вывод команды lspci | grep -i vga:

00:02.0 VGA compatible controller: Intel Corporation 2nd Generation Core Processor Family Integrated Graphics Controller (rev 09)
01:00.0 VGA compatible controller: Advanced Micro Devices [AMD] nee ATI Whistler XT [AMD Radeon HD 6700M Series]

Вывод команды uname -a:

Linux calculate 3.6.6-calculate #1 SMP PREEMPT Wed Nov 7 11:17:55 UTC 2012 x86_64 Intel(R) Core(TM) i3-2330M CPU @ 2.20GHz GenuineIntel GNU/Linux

Логи xorg в момент падения: http://pastebin.com/rridkHA2
Конфиг xorg.conf, сгенерированный через aticonfig --initial: http://pastebin.com/Q4438rnS

Ядро собрано с поддержкой DRI ?

Потому что вот строка с лога:

 (EE) Failed to load module "dri2" (module does not exist, 0)

Ну и плюс в логе четко написано:

 this is a Muxless PX A+I platform, we doesn't supported it

Забиваем это сроку в Google там куча информации об этой проблеме, правда за 20минут поиска решения я не нашел.

А зачем нужен fglrx и почему не воспользоваться radeon?
radeon работает когда ATI второй картой?

У меня тоже ноут с ATI правда без спарки, я с fglrx вечно проблемы имел, перещел на readeon и никаких вопросов.

а мне вот это очень помогает http://en.gentoo-wiki.com/wiki/Radeon#LM_sensors
з.ы.не обращай внимание на концовку ссылки , там реально много полезного :wink:

Говорят, что открытый драйвер radeon не поддерживает 3D ускорение, да и c 2D технологиями он уступает проприетарному, особенно разница видна в играх и т.п. А т.к. со всем остальным прекрасно справляется интегрированная видеокарта, хотелось бы, чтобы дискретная работала как положено.
Обновил ядро, xorg-server, video-intel … С dri модулем проблема решилась, но теперь всё падает с segmentation fault, что при установке пакета ati-drivers с portage, что при скачивании с офф сайта. Я уже не знаю, что и делать …

Если можете подсказать что-нибудь, буду очень благодарен.

Логи после установки ati-drivers: http://pastebin.com/fp3rbfRX
Логи после установки пакета с сайта amd: http://pastebin.com/vNBp3eV1

аналогично всё падает с segmentation на ядре 3.6.7 , xorg-server-13,0 , ati-drivers-12.11_beta… откатил на старое ядро 3.4.5 , x11-base/xorg-server-12,4 , x11-drivers/ati-drivers-12,6 всё заработало (правда интела у меня нету ) … пересобeру мир попробую ещё раз ))

хаха …а на других (кальковских) ядрах таже хня … на амд64 с ядром 3.6.6 всё работало . И дёрнул-же меня вайн на х86 перелезть )))

Разве для WINEARCH=win32 не помогал для WINE?

у меня всегда были проблемы с линухой х86 …поэтому поверь на слово , вынужденно ((

вообще-то речь идет про принудительное указание архитектуры WINE (актуально для x86_64), а не всей системы…

 WINEARCH=win32 WINEPREFIX=~/new_wine32 winecfg

создаст в 64-битной системе 32-битную “бутылку” ~/new_wine32 и запустит winecfg

мне таким образом удалось поставить dotnet и еще некоторые проги, требующие x86

это всё понятно , но работает вайн в 64 битной среде …

Как то все отвлеклись от основной темы =)

Поставил ядро 3.4.18 (3.4.5 уже нет в portage), но 12.11 там не компилятся, а если ставить 12.6, то нужно откатывать xorg-server на 12 версию и ещё какие-то пакеты вместе с ним … Как то не очень хочется делать даунгрейд кучи пакетов, да ещё и на старом ядре сидеть. По видимому, лучше подождать следующей версии драйверов и надеяться, что они будут нормально компилиться и работать на новых ядрах.

Виталий Ерёменко wrote:

Поставил ядро 3.4.18 (3.4.5 уже нет в portage)

могу попозже ebuild 3.4.5 скинуть (calculate-sources-3.4 тоже в наличии) :slight_smile:

забил на эту непонятку с атишным драйвером 12.11 (и на вайн тоже) в х86 и вернулся на амд64 (тут всё работает ) - :slight_smile: